#include "FP.h" |
|
#include <stdint.h> |
|
|
|
template<class retT, class argT> |
|
FP<retT, argT>::FP() |
|
{ |
|
obj_callback = 0; |
|
c_callback = 0; |
|
} |
|
|
|
template<class retT, class argT> |
|
bool FP<retT, argT>::attached() |
|
{ |
|
return obj_callback || c_callback; |
|
} |
|
|
|
|
|
template<class retT, class argT> |
|
void FP<retT, argT>::detach() |
|
{ |
|
obj_callback = 0; |
|
c_callback = 0; |
|
} |
|
|
|
|
|
template<class retT, class argT> |
|
void FP<retT, argT>::attach(retT (*function)(argT)) |
|
{ |
|
c_callback = function; |
|
} |
|
|
|
template<class retT, class argT> |
|
retT FP<retT, argT>::operator()(argT arg) const |
|
{ |
|
if( 0 != c_callback ) |
|
{ |
|
return obj_callback ? (obj_callback->*method_callback)(arg) : (*c_callback)(arg); |
|
} |
|
return (retT)0; |
|
} |
